Dongroa... Donsi... Doti

dongroa adj. having stunted growth. Dis lee bwai soh smaal, hihn mos dongroa. This little boy is so small, his growth must be stunted. See: duwaaf.

 

dongstayz adv. downstairs; first floor, ground floor. Wi mi deh dongstayz eena di yaad wen di gyal dehn reech. We were downstairs in the yard when the girls arrived.
dongstayz hows n.phr. lower flat or storey of a house. Mi aanti bil wahn opstayz ahn dongstayz hows kaa shee waahn Ai liv dongstayz a shee. My aunt built a two-storied house because she wants me to live downstairs from her.

 

 

donsi adj. dumb, mentally slow. Yoo oanli di play donsi! Mee noa seh yu don laan yu tayblz. You're only acting like a dunce! I know that you have already learned your times tables. See: dol, dom, haad hed.

 

 

doo Variant: du. v. do. Emphatic Ah doo ga di moni fi chroo, bot Ah noh waahn len ahn. I really do have the money, but I don't want to lend it.

 

 

dos v. dust. Wen di man faal dong aaf a ih baisikl, ih get op ahn dos aaf ihself. When the man fell off his bicycle, he got up and dusted himself off.n. dust. Shee noh reed ih Baibl soh lang til dos di setl pahn it. She hasn't read her Bible in so long that dust is settling on it.

 

 

doti adj. dirty. Chroa da doti ting da grong. Throw that dirty thing on the ground. doti op v.phr. dirty, pollute. Aal dehn gyaabij weh dehn chroa eena di see di du da doti op di see. All that garbage that they throw in the sea pollutes it. See: chrash op.

Kriol is the language spoken by many Belizeans, especially the Creole people of Belize. Although it is often perceived as a dialect of English, it is indeed it's own language with grammar and spelling rules. The National Kriol Council of Belize was created to promote the culture and language of the Kriol people of Belize, as well as harmony among all the ethnic groups of Belize.
